Dec. 1, 2017Friday The DO Staff Contact The DO Staff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Email A new report from the National Academies of Sciences, Engineering and Medicine, released on Thursday, offers recommendations for curbing the cost of prescription drugs without inhibiting innovation in drug development. Jennie H. Kwon, DO, MSCI, in her role as an anniversary fellow in osteopathic medicine with the National Academy of Medicine, helped write the report.
